Teguh was dishonorably discharged as a policeman due to his sexual orientation. With the support of his partner Tonny, Teguh decided to purue justice by bringing his case to court, an act that has never been done before in Indonesia from the LGBTQI+ community. From this, the question arises, why would he put himself in potential danger by going against the institution? The film tells a love story between Teguh and Tonny, which becomes the foundation of why this fight needs to be fought for.
